We're not going to (overly) question the design decisions of other pools, but we will say
that some other pools seem to implement a lot of "gimmicks" that proportedly improve
performance. HikariCP achieves high-performance even in pools beyond realistic deployment
sizes. Either these "gimmicks" are a case of premature optimization, poor design, or lack
of understanding of how to leaverage what the JVM JIT can do to full effect.
